“Good location but ....”
2 of 5 stars Reviewed 16 September 2007

The hotel is in an excellent location (although we were told by the owner not to park our car there as it would more than likely get broken into and I wouldn't recommend that single females walk alone at night), the rooms are clean and have the basics for a short stay.

However, the owner and reception staff are probably the rudest we have ever come across. We were told to pay in advance, which we tried to do constantly but for some reason their charge machine would not work - they only seemed interested in accepting cash which after the way we'd been treated we refused to do. The owner was adamant that there were enough towels in the room even after I searched every single cupboard only to find one for the two of us (no hand towels either). And don't dare try to leave the hotel with your room key - even if it is just to pop out to the car for something small.

So, for a budget stay in a clean hotel I'd say yes but the owner is one of the most frustrating people I've ever had to converse with.

“OK for a budget hotel”
2 of 5 stars Reviewed 21 March 2007

As far as Brussels hotels are concerned, the Chantecler falls in the cheap category, so it's an option if you are in a tight budget. The location in the lower town is indeed quite convenient, there are many shops, cafes and bars around, the Grand Place is a few blocks away, the Bourse metro station is two blocks away and you can walk to and from the Central station in around 10 minutes (from is easier than to, it's downhill).

I stayed in one of the back rooms, which means no noise from other rooms or the bar across the street, but with a view to a ventilation shaft. The room was very badly lit and rather small for a twin, unlike the bathroom which was actually quite large. The room looks outdated and a bit worn, but it looked and smelled clean (too much disinfectant). The breakfast (included in the price) consisted of bread rolls that you got yourself from a plastic bag, marmelade, butter, juice, milk and coffee.

Oddly, you have to pay up front for the room, and it seems as if the hotel gets walk in customers (there is a large sign with the prices outside and photos of the rooms at the entrance). The staff seems disinterested, but when asked for information they are quite helpful and all spoke good english.

On the other hand, this is not the only cheap hotel in the area, but in late March 2007 this was the only one available, so I gave it a try. Having been to other nearby hotels in the past, I would not go back to that one again, you can certainly do better for the same money if you book a bit more in advance.
